Rumours from Toronto for Late October
Police raids on suspected Colombian cartel members within Toronto continued today, after almost a week of calm. At least 15 are dead after a series of pinpoint attacks against drug dealers in the downtown core, as well as several suppliers located in Scarborough.
A warehouse fire near harbourfront has claimed at least nine lives. Police sources have revealed that the blaze is considered to be arson, and that at least some of the dead had been shot prior to the setting of the fire.
Municipal elections are to be held November 13th. A record number of candidates have declared against Mel Lastman, including Grant Bohr, a popular councilor. Mel Lastman, however, holds a commanding 50 point lead.
Eighteen police officers have been arrested and charged with corruption offences. No further details were released by police.
Gangrel-Ventrue forces continue to close in on Tremere holdings in London, England. Harpies are reporting that it is considered only a matter of time before the Chantry itself falls.
Negotiations continue in Detroit regarding the selection of a Prince for that city. No word has been released regarding the situation.
